Distracted Driver Crashes into Concrete Barrier on Interstate 80

BEAVER TWP., Pa. (EYT) — Police say a vehicle crashed into a concrete barrier along Interstate 80 in Beaver Township early Tuesday morning.

According to police, around 6:09 a.m. on Tuesday, November 20, Jody L. Resseguie, 59, of Hallstead, was operating traveling west on Interstate 80 near the 58.6 mile marker in a 2017 Ford Edge.

Resseguie became distracted as he looked down at his gas gauge which resulted in the vehicle exiting the right side of the roadawy where it struck a concrete barrier, according to police.

Resseguie and his passenger — 56-year-old Eileen M. Resseguie of Hallstead — were both wearing seatbelts and were not injured.

The left front tie rod of the vehicle broke as a result of the collision. The vehicle was towed from the scene by Frye’s Garage.
